Positive Scenarios

Agentic tools can materially improve productivity in sectors with repetitive digital work. Customer service, sales outreach, HR operations, internal IT support, and finance workflows can benefit because agents can triage requests, draft responses, pull data, and trigger actions faster than manual teams.salesforce+2

In business terms, this can mean faster cycle times, lower service costs, better consistency, and more time for human workers to focus on complex problems. One example is Klarna, which reported a 40% drop in customer service costs per transaction from Q1 2023 to Q1 2025 while maintaining customer satisfaction levels, and said AI helped lift revenue per employee and reduce response times.customerexperiencedive+1

Negative Scenarios

The downside is that productivity narratives can overpromise and underdeliver when firms treat AI as a plug-in rather than a redesign project. Research and industry reporting show that many firms report no meaningful productivity or earnings impact because the tools are not embedded deeply enough into processes, controls, and incentives.buildmvpfast+2

There are also labor and trust risks. Some companies reduce headcount, others redeploy workers, and some later rehire humans when AI cannot fully handle edge cases, emotional situations, or accountability-heavy tasks. Klarna’s later move to add more human support shows that AI-first models often settle into hybrid human-machine systems rather than fully automated ones.customerexperiencedive+1

Sector Value

The real contribution of agentic AI differs by sector. In white-collar, process-heavy work, the value is often immediate because agents can compress research, drafting, routing, and reporting. In physical industries, the impact is slower because current systems still struggle with hands-on tasks, sensory complexity, and real-world variability.hiringlab

SectorLikely valueMain limitation
Customer serviceFaster resolution, lower cost per case, 24/7 coverage klarna+1.Complex or emotional cases still need humans.
Sales and marketingFaster prospecting, personalization, and campaign execution buildmvpfast.Risk of generic output and brand inconsistency.
HR and internal opsFaster onboarding, policy support, and ticket handling salesforce+1.Sensitive decisions require oversight and fairness controls.
Public sectorBetter staffing support, document processing, and service delivery oecd.Governance, compliance, and public trust matter more.
Manufacturing and logisticsPlanning and coordination gains, especially in back-office operations hiringlab.Physical execution still limits full autonomy.
Health and careAdministrative support and information retrieval hiringlab.Clinical and human-care tasks cannot be broadly automated.
